FacilitiesIndoor Swimming PoolJack Purcell Pool's uniqueness is that the water temperature is 92 Fahrenheit and is accessible to individuals with mobility impairments. The pool has an electric transfer lift and graduating stairs with arm support to enter the pool. It also has a full length metal hand rail and full length rope on opposite side.
